About Forefront
Forefront – The Next Evolution of VR WarfareFrom the creators of Breachers and Hyper Dash, Forefront delivers an all-out war experience like never before in VR. Engage in massive 32-player battles with cross-play across platforms, a variety of expansive maps, and semi-destructible environments, where strategy, skill, and teamwork decide the outcome.🚁 Command land, sea, and air vehicles – Pilot helicopters, drive tanks, and storm objectives in humvees, quads, or boats.🔫 Choose your class – Play as Assault, Engineer, Medic, or Sniper, each with specialized weapons, attachments, and gadgets you unlock by progressing your soldier and class levels.🔥 Feel the impact – Realistic gun play, tactical movement, and large-scale combat bring the battlefield to life.💥 Shape the fight – Blast through walls, demolish buildings, and use destruction to create new paths or deny enemy cover.The year is 2035. A powerful energy corporation, O.R.E., has built a private military to defend its monopoly on Red Orpiment, a rare mineral set to power the world, while local governments and resistance fighters battle to reclaim control. "No VR Device Detected" I am unable to play the game since launch because of this error, it has been an issue since last december and is a reported bug. I am using a Vive Pro 2 with a wireless mod and suspect its because the display is being routed through my CPU to the WiGig card. so, im an idiot. I figured it out. when I installed SteamVR I followed steams's instructions and set it to the default OpenXR. The fixes for this issue all say to do that too, but for this particular headset, (even wired, the wireless mod had nothing to do with it) you HAVE to use the version of OpenXR it downloads when you install the software for it. It installes a custom version of the platform that is only for 64 bit and probably does something under the hood to make the headset compatible with games. DO NOT change the openXR setting if you have a Vive Pro 2! If you DID change the setting, you will have to purge every piece of vive and steamvr from your pc and then do a DDU clean install of your graphics drivers to make it work again.
